New contractor notes. The Corvane LB marks nodes unhealthy after three failed probes. If a bad deploy makes every node fail its health check, the whole pool goes dark and normal access is locked out. That's the break-glass case. Use the standalone bypass console, force one node healthy, then roll back. Do not edit probe thresholds during an incident. Log everything in the Harkwell incident tracker within 30 minutes. The bypass console prompts for the recovery passphrase shown below.

unlock words, hahip-baduf: holwyn-istath-julvan

Subject: Diffscope large-file viewer now in release branch

The Diffscope viewer now streams files over 50 MB in chunks instead of loading them whole, which resolves the memory spikes reported last sprint. Syntax highlighting is disabled above the threshold by design. Future maintainers should keep the chunk size conservative. The build that introduced this change is identified below.

session token of tajef-bageg = htk21_5d90d574934f3ccae6437

**Ticket FV-2291: Fuel-usage report shows negative consumption for the Harbor Ridge depot**

So the weekly fleet fuel report is claiming three vans at Harbor Ridge *produced* fuel last week, which would be great if it were true. Looks like odometer rollbacks from the telematics feed aren't being filtered before the delta calc. Workaround: exclude the depot from the aggregate until the filter lands. Repro data is attached to the run whose token is pasted below.

pipeline stamp: htk3_69f

// MAX_LINE_ITEMS_PER_PAGE caps rows rendered per page in the Quillbarn
// invoice PDF pipeline. Exceeding it forces a page break; the footer totals
// repeat on continuation pages. Do not raise without testing the Fennwick
// layout templates — glyph metrics overflow silently above 42 rows.
// Changing this invalidates cached renders, so bump the cache epoch too.
// The renderer stamps each output with the build that produced it.

build token for yajop-kawif: htk21_21d141fe127ea0a15af2b

Snapshot failures on Lanternkit PRs are usually font-rendering drift on the CI runners, not real regressions. Diff the images before approving an update; a one-pixel shift across every component means environment noise. Re-run once. If it persists, update snapshots in a separate commit. Reference the CI trace token shown directly below.

pipeline stamp: htk6_35e0c9